Strain Theory
A sociological theory that posits societal structures may pressure citizens to commit crimes by placing emphasis on goals that are not achievable through legitimate means for everyone.
Chivalry Hypothesis
The theory suggesting that societal norms and judicial systems are more lenient towards women than men, hence expecting them to be treated with leniency and gallantry in situations of legal transgression.
Federal Institutions
Organizations or entities that are part of a national government system, which have specific responsibilities and powers as defined by law or constitution.
Biological Perspectives
Approaches in science that emphasize the importance of biological processes and genetic factors in understanding human behavior and traits.
